Steve Bergman <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> writes: > A while back I reported that the rocketport (rocket.o) driver in > mandrake 8.2/cooker (which is old) had problems with modern > rocketport boards. (The latest drivers work fine. The earlier > driver drops characters and does other funky things.) > > Comtrol, the manufacturer, says that it works under RedHat and SuSE, > but not under Mandrake because "Mandrake is not System V > compatible". (Each time I requested more detail, I was told only > that "Mandrake is not System V compatible". Go figure...) > > Oddly, RedHat, SuSE, and Mandrake use exactly the same driver > version (1.14c), which diffs out *almost* identically. There is one > typo in Mandrake's rocket_int.h. (There is an extraneous "*/" on a > line.) > > I notice that as of Aug 14, this typo has been corrected. > > Was this just house cleaning? Or was it causing the problems? > > I'm very curious, but not in a position to test it as the hardware > in question is now in a production machine.
